Refund Offers Cushioning the Blow of Reductions

Cashback offers at Spinstein Casino are promoted as a protective measure, refunding a percentage of net losses either as bonus credit or actual cash. The standard UK deal runs on a Monday as a 10% weekend cashback on slots only, calculated from Friday to Sunday net losses. If a cashback is awarded as cash, it is bound by only a 1x wagering demand, which is exceptionally player-friendly and uncommon in the sector. When added as bonus money, the standard 35x condition returns, lessening the charm. A critical point for UK players is the exclusion of table shortfalls from the assessment; if you devoted the weekend at the blackjack tables and left down substantially, you will not see a single unit. Furthermore, the cashback sum is usually capped at £100, implying high-volume players won´t regain larger deficits proportionately. While the 1x cashback remains a bright spot, it questions the notion that this deal truly “softens the sting” for loyal high-stakes punters.

Deciphering Wagering Requirements and Terms

Wagering requirements remain the most critical factor when deciding whether a UK-targeted bonus offers real worth, and Spinstein Casino is no exception. Most promotional funds here have a 35x to 45x playthrough requirement on the bonus amount, which falls within an industry-average band. Free spin winnings are usually subject to a separate 40x wagering clause, a figure that can quickly convert a seemingly generous batch of spins into a grind. Crucially, the terms detail that different games account for varying percentages towards clearance. Slots typically count 100%, but table games such as blackjack and roulette may only account for 5% or 10%, effectively making a 40x requirement impossible to clear on those titles alone. UK players should also consider the maximum bet cap of £5 during active bonus play, a sensible responsible-gambling measure but one that slows down high rollers. Time windows are tight; welcome bonuses often lapse after 21 days, which creates rushed sessions that can hinder strategic play.
